Omodos
Built at the slope of the mountain, between a verdant carpet of vines, surrounded by mountains that appear as though they were placed in a masterly layout, is one of the most picturesque villages of Cyprus. The large plaza of the village, with the tiny quaint houses with the tiled roofs, clustered around the ever-present churches and the paved flowery yards, only begin to describe its beauty. A guided tour in the colorful cobblestoned square, surrounded by coffee houses, taverns and shops where home handicraft flourishes will lead us to one of the oldest and more historic monasteries of the island! The Monastery of the Holy Cross The Ornament and true pride and joy of the village that rises majestically in the village square, a significant part of Cyprus's cultural heritage. The Monastery was established before St. Helen's arrival in Cyprus in 327 A.D...
